The Capolla system was the location of at least one habitable world, Capolla VI, and as of 3145 was located in the Republic of the Sphere.[2][3]
Contents
System Description[edit]
The Capolla system is located close to the Brownsville and Elgin systems[4] and consisted of a class F6VI primary orbited by nine planets.[1]
System History[edit]
The Capolla system was colonized during or shortly after the First Exodus from Terra,[5] following the discovery of the habitable world of Capolla VI in the twenty-second century.[1]

Capolla VI, more commonly known simply as Capolla, is the sixth planet of nine in the Capolla system and has a single moon named Nobel.[1]
Planetary History[edit]
Early History[edit]
Capolla had a long and productive relationship with the neighboring world of Terra Firma. The two worlds often worked together to meet their mutual needs. Capolla's large ore deposits and other raw materials made it well-suited for industrial production. Combined with Terra Firma's agricultural output the two worlds formed a strong economic block in their area. Their economic power was so great that they were given significant freedom of action when they joined the Terran Hegemony.[1]
This relative independence would be honored by every interstellar power who later tried to claim the two worlds;[1] Capolla was one of some fifty-one heavily contested worlds to have been placed under Terran Hegemony authority as a jointly administered world during the Age of War or Star League era. During the First Succession War Capolla once more became a flashpoint between the Free Worlds League and Capellan Confederation.[12]
Third Succession War[edit]
In the last decade of the Third Succession War, the Black Inferno mercenary unit pillaged sites all around the Inner Sphere, driving people from their lands to unearth lost Star League facilities. One of their stops was in Marik space near the Liao border, creating an international crisis when refugees had no choice but to cross into Liao territory. The local governor on Hsien refused to allow them passage home, prompting Marik to hire a mercenary group to assassinate the governor to teach House Liao a lesson and open up the border. Instead, Liao doubled down and launched raids against border posts, forcing Marik to respond in kind and destroy a urban military logistics center on Capolla to weaken the CCAF enough to allow the refugees to return.[39]
Fourth Succession War[edit]
Following negotiations between Colonel Pavel Ridzik, chief military advisor to Chancellor Maximilian Liao, and AFFS Lieutenant General Ardan Sortek, conducted in February 3029 Ridzik created a new nation, the Tikonov Free Republic. The Republic was created by incorporating those worlds of the Tikonov Commonality that hadn't already been conquered during the first half of the Fourth Succession War. Ridzik returned to Elgin, the new capital of the Tikonov Free Republic, on the 3rd of March 3029 and swiftly began implementing a new government consisting of family members, friends and other appointees loyal to himself, purging dissident elements on the various Republic worlds and taking the opportunity to settle old scores. Capolla was one of the systems incorporated into the Republic.[20]
The Jihad[edit]
After the chaos of Operation GUERRERO Terra Firma and Capolla joined forces to form the Terracap Confederation. This small organization existed until the Word of Blake established their Protectorate and encouraged the two worlds to join. Even the Blakists only administered the world with a light hand. In exchange however the Capollians allowed the Blakists to station troops and build "reeducation centers" on the world. The Capollians studiously ignored the rumors and rumblings that came from those facilities for most of the Jihad.[1]
An interview conducted by Cristen Gardner of MERCNET in early 3077 gave the mercenary unit Deliah's Gauntlet the opportunity to speak about the incorporation of Capolla into the Protectorate, and the reasons behind the Gauntlet fleeing from Capolla in 3076. Finn indicated that the Blakists had initially treated the population and the mercenaries well, giving the population substantial liberties and a feeling of freedom, but from 3072 onwards the Word had actively cultivated a restrictive, paranoid attitude among the population, similar to that of the days when Capolla had been a part of the Capellan Confederation. This reached a peak in 3075, when paranoia and suspicion combined with rumors of the presence of weapons of mass destruction led elements of the civilian population and local Militia to treat the resident population from the One Star Faith as scapegoats, based on the advanced technology the Faithful possessed.[31]
Having struck against the Faithful, the Militia then mustered to attack the Gauntlet, who managed to flee into the jungle before the Militia engaged. Supported with supplies and information from the local population, the Gauntlet managed to fight a guerrilla war against the Militia forces, avoiding major confrontations and engagements, until the Militia massed to strike against them. The Gauntlet defeated the militia at the cost of a lance of their own 'Mechs and one of their MechWarriors; the Gauntlet then managed to seize a Union-class DropShip from the Militia and escape off world, although they were unable to rescue the surviving One Star Faithful left on Capolla.[31]
When Operation SCOUR came to the world, the militia split nearly evenly down pro-Blakist and anti-Blakist lines. The resulting combat heavily damaged the cities, which required significant rebuilding.[1]
Dark Age[edit]
In a deal between Clan Sea Fox and the Republic of the Sphere a factory to produce ClanTech units, specifically the Roadrunner but potentially others, was inaugurated in 3112. It was scheduled to pass from Sea Fox control to Republic regulations in 3127.[40] Capolla was captured by the Capellan Confederation during Operation BÀOYÌNG in 3150[36]

Geography[edit]
Capolla has four major landmasses; two of these continents, Dominus and Konowalchuk, lie on the equator, while Matlabor is at the south pole. The fourth continent, New Australia, is a large island continent located in the northern hemisphere. Much of the three warmer continents on Capolla are covered with jungles.[1]
